2. Desperado Roller Coaster

Desperado Roller Coaster, Primm, Nevada is one of the destinations we recommend you stop by on the Los Angeles to Zion National Park route. It’s 227 miles from Los Angeles, and it’ll take about 3 hours and 30 mins of driving.

Desperado Roller Coaster in Primm, Nevada is a thrilling ride for thrill-seekers. It moves at an insane speed of 80 mph, giving you a wild ride and an adrenaline rush. It is not overly expensive, so it is worth the experience. However, the hours of operation are not advertised online and it can be difficult to reach a person to verify when the coaster is running. Despite this, we made a special trip out there from the Las Vegas strip and found the roller coaster and log ride ran every other hour and on Fridays, Saturdays, and Sundays. We waited for 55 minutes in total, but the ride itself was great. Unfortunately, there was no apology or offer of a free ride due to the delay. That said, Desperado Roller Coaster is a great place to visit on a road trip from Los Angeles to Zion National Park and is well worth it for thrill-seekers looking for an exciting ride.

4. Moapa Valley National Wildlife Refuge

Do you also like to travel and experience new things? Then, it would be best to visit Moapa Valley National Wildlife Refuge, Moapa, Nevada on the Los Angeles to Zion National Park road trip. Moapa Valley National Wildlife Refuge is 326 miles from Los Angeles, and you can arrive there after the 4 hours and 57 mins of drive.

Moapa Valley National Wildlife Refuge is an excellent stop for a road trip from Los Angeles to Zion National Park. While the refuge is small, it is home to plenty of nature to explore, including the Moapa Dace, an endangered fish species. There are a few short hiking trails and a viewing area with docents to explain the purpose of the refuge and the endangered fish. The area is best visited during cooler months as it is not open during the summer. Right across the street is an excellent spot for picnicking and hiking, with plenty of shade and restrooms. Moapa Valley National Wildlife Refuge is definitely worth taking a half an hour to explore during your road trip.

7. The Narrows

You can visit many destinations on your Los Angeles to Zion National Park journey. One of these destinations is The Narrows located in, Zion National Park, Utah. You can arrive at The Narrows after 7 hours of driving.

The Narrows is a must-see stop on any Zion National Park road trip. It’s an adventurous and unique hike that takes you on a journey through the river, surrounded by towering walls of sandstone. We visited in November, and the temperature was perfect for hiking – about 55 degrees. Renting dry pants and canyoneering boots from Zion Outfitters was a mistake, as the equipment wasn’t designed to keep our feet dry. We’d suggest renting from Zion Guru by La Quinta Inn instead, as their dry pants come with a sock and foot part, ensuring you stay totally dry! Even in the summer, your feet can stay cool due to the river’s temperature, but if you don’t want wet feet, it’s best to come prepared with wooden walking poles and canyoneering boots. The Narrows is Zion’s most popular and dangerous hiking trail due to the risk of flash floods, so make sure to take all the necessary precautions before embarking on your hike.
